Graduate Web Developer

Details:ehealth4everyone Limited in Abuja is looking for an outstanding Web Developer who can implement functional web-based software using HTML, CSS, JavaScript and other related web languages.His/her role will be to design, build and maintain web applications. Required minimum: knowledge of Javascript – Jquery, Angular 2 and NodeJS – and any server-side language.Responsibilities

Write well-designed, testable, efficient code by using best software development practices
Create web layout/user interfaces using HTML5/CSS (Boot Straps)
Integrate data from various back-end services and databases
Gather and refine specifications and requirements based on technical needs
Create and maintain software documentation and project reports.
Adapt emerging technologies and apply them into new software development and activities
Train and support staff on web maintenance and management.
Support external collaborators through maintaining web linkages, APIs and interoperability interfaces with other platforms.
Develop and discuss web design mock ups with graphics designers, and cooperate with graphic designer to match visual design intent.
Support the development of dashboards.
Manage, guide and supervise the activities and outputs of colleagues and interns, as required.

Requirements:

Demonstrable knowledge of front-end technologies such as HTML5, CSS, JavaScript, and AJAX.
Good knowledge of relational and structural databases and how to create database schemas that represent and support business processes
Understanding fundamental design principles behind a scalable application
Sound knowledge of version control tools such as git.
Strong knowledge of web server exploits and their solutions
Passion for best design and coding practices, and a desire to develop new interesting ideas
Top-notch programming skills and in-depth knowledge of modern web development technology
A solid understanding of how web applications work including security and session management.
Basic knowledge of Search Engine Optimisation (SEO)
Aggressive problem diagnosis and creative problem solving skills
Strong organisational skills to juggle multiple tasks within the constraints of timelines and budgets with high quality.
Ability to work and thrive in a fast-paced environment, learn rapidly and master diverse web technologies and techniques.

Qualifications:

Has experience in web development
Has at least a portfolio of 1 completed web application project.
Degree in Computer Science or any ICT related field.
Sound knowledge of Microsoft Office (Excel, Word and PowerPoint).
Detail oriented, flexible, self-motivated and meeting deadlines.

Salary: N50, 000 per monthThis job description summarizes the main duties of the job. It neither prescribes nor restricts the exact tasks that may be assigned to carry out these duties. This document should not be construed in any way to represent a contract of employment. The team reserves the right to review and revise this document at any time.

Apply via :

e.com